On 12/5/11 3:59 PM, Inci Cetindil wrote:
I was trying to use NullWritable as the type of my edge values. But it causes
an IllegalAccessException when BspUtils.createEdgeValue() method tries to
instantiate it; since NullWritable is Singleton with a private constructor. Is
there a way to use NullWritable, or do I need to use another Writable?
